What Do Electricians Mean by Wiring Upgrades?

Wiring upgrades refer to the structured removal and installation of existing electrical wiring, conductors, and associated components to match today's safety and capacity requirements. This goes well beyond just replacing a breaker or fuse. A full wiring upgrade means running fresh conductors throughout the structure. The type of wiring being replaced shapes how the job is approached.

Aluminum branch-circuit wiring, installed widely in the 1960s and 1970s presents specific hazards that modern copper wiring simply does not. Knob-and-tube offers zero equipment grounding protection and its insulation becomes brittle with age. Aluminum branch-circuit wiring expands and contracts differently than copper, which creates fire hazards at terminals. Wiring upgrades solve these problems at the root.

From a technical standpoint, the work starts with safely shutting down affected circuits and pulling old wire and installing new copper wire of the correct gauge. New devices — outlets, switches, and fixtures replace all old hardware throughout the system. Each completed circuit undergoes testing under load to ensure proper voltage and continuity.

The Wiring Upgrades Procedure in Detail

  1. Whole-System Inspection — One of our certified professionals comes to your home and completes a thorough inspection of the existing wiring. We note the conductor material, age, and condition throughout and mark any circuits that pose active risks. This inspection drives the scope of the project.
  2. Custom Scope and Project Proposal — Drawing from the initial evaluation, our team prepares a detailed written proposal. We clarify what can be retained and what must be changed and provide transparent, itemized pricing. Applicable local permits are addressed here so you're protected throughout the project.
  3. Securing Permits and Setting the Work Date — Our office manages all required paperwork on your behalf. Scheduling accounts for the size of the project and your schedule. We make sure the required inspections are built into the timeline so every completed phase gets signed off.
  4. Active Wiring Upgrade Work — Our certified crew safely shut down the circuits being upgraded before pulling out existing conductors and hardware. Properly-rated NEC-compliant conductors is pulled through walls, conduit, and framing. Modern code-compliant devices at every termination point are installed at every connection point.
  5. Load Testing and Circuit Verification — After all new conductors are in place, the upgraded circuits are energized. Our team uses calibrated test equipment to confirm correct ampacity, polarity, and fault protection. Anything that doesn't pass verification are corrected before moving on.
  6. Official Inspection and Permit Closure — The local building department inspector examines the finished work to verify code compliance at every circuit. We are present for every inspection to address any questions in real time. Sign-off from the inspector wraps up the official documentation, giving you documented proof of the upgrade.
  7. Final Walkthrough and Client Handoff — Before we consider the job complete, a member of our team walks the property with you. We explain what was upgraded, where, and why, make sure you understand your new electrical system. You receive copies of the permit and inspection records for documentation purposes.

Is wiring that hasn't caused problems still a hazard?

Age alone doesn't make wiring automatically catastrophic — but deterioration is predictable and the hazards accumulate. Knob-and-tube wiring that has been covered with insulation can and does cause fires. We give you a clear picture of what's actually there — and from there, you make an informed decision.
